Ceccano is a charming town located in the province of Frosinone, in the Lazio region of central Italy. Situated on a hilltop, it offers breathtaking views of the surrounding countryside. The town is steeped in history, with its roots dating back to ancient times, making it a fascinating destination for history enthusiasts.
One of the highlights of Ceccano is its well-preserved medieval historic center. Walking through its narrow cobblestone streets, visitors can admire the beautifully restored buildings and picturesque squares. The imposing Rocca dei Conti d'Aquino, a medieval fortress, dominates the town's skyline and is a must-visit attraction. From the top of the fortress, visitors can enjoy panoramic views of Ceccano and the surrounding valley.
Another notable site in Ceccano is the Church of Santa Maria a Fiume. This Romanesque church is known for its stunning architecture and beautiful frescoes. Inside, visitors can admire the intricate details of the artwork and experience a sense of tranquility.
